HP Envy 15 Model J104SL
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)

Hi everyone, 

I've been having overheating and fan noise on my laptop lately, so I cleaned the vent and replaced the thermal paste (haven't touched it in the last 7 years). My laptop does not overheat anymore, but the vent is still a bit noisy. Is there a chance that i will solve the problem by buying a new vent? Will this actually help? If so, what kind of vent should I buy?

I already tried vent speed-regulating softwares and changed the settings in the CPU cooling section ecc.

By "vent" I am guessing you mean "fan". Here is the Service Manual:

 

Manual 

 

The fan is this part:

 

(14) Fan (includes cable) 720235-001

 

HP itself will no longer stock this. 

 

HP Envy 15-J 15-Q 17-J TPN-L110 TPN-L111 ventola di raffreddamento della CPU 720235-001 720539-001 |...

 

Many of these are for sale on eBay Italy. See p. 63 of the Manual for instructions.

Yes fans wear out. They spin very fast and the bearings can get worn and get noisy. A new fan almost always fixes the issue.
